Steven Atkinson: A Beloved Son and Twin Brother

Steven Atkinson, aged 31, passed away suddenly on Friday 29th May 2026. He is described as a dearly beloved son of Catherine and Anthony, brother to Alan and Kevin, and twin brother of Scott. He was a partner to Paula and father to Steven-Joe, Anthony, Olivia, Hallie, and the late Catherine. His funeral service was held at West Road Crematorium on Wednesday 24th June at 11:45am.

Other Tributes

Michael Armstrong, aged 74, died peacefully at home on 3rd June. He is survived by his wife Margaret, daughters Wendy and Margaret, and grandchildren. His cremation took place at West Road Crematorium on 29th June.

Alice Green, aged 77, passed away in Ashington on 17th June. She is remembered as a much-loved wife of Bobby and a devoted mother and grandmother.

John McAdam, aged 84, died peacefully on 12th June. He was a beloved husband of the late Pat and a much-loved dad of Paul and Michael.

Joe Stewart, aged 81, passed away peacefully in hospital on 16th June. He was a much-loved husband of Jean and a loving father, grandfather, and great-grandfather.

Diane Cuthbertson, aged 79, died peacefully at home on 13th June. She is survived by her children Carl, David, and Lisa, and her grandchildren.

Peter Stempczyk, aged 63, passed away peacefully on 12th June with his family by his side. He was a devoted husband to Carolyn and a loving father and grandfather.
